S*0158 (Rat #0532, Act #0425 of 1982) General Bill, By D.S. Rushing, Leventis and M.B. Williams
Similar (H 2365)
    A Bill to amend Section 12-3-145, as amended, Code of Laws of South Carolina, 1976, relating to the procedures required to obtain certificates of exemption status from the South Carolina Tax Commission for property to be exempt from ad valorem taxation, so as to provide that libraries, churches, parsonages and burying grounds shall only be required to file an initial application requesting that their property be exempt from such taxation, to provide exceptions, and to extend the deadline for filing such applications to December 31, 1982, for certain tax years.-at
